Our Carbon-Aramid Hybrid Fabric exemplifies the synergy of advanced composite technology, blending the exceptional strength and lightweight nature of carbon fibers with the remarkable toughness and impact resistance of aramid fibers. This innovative hybrid fabric enhances performance by providing an unparalleled fusion of mechanical properties, making it an ideal choice for a diverse range of cutting-edge applications.

Advantages

Strength and Stiffness:
Our cutting-edge carbon fiber delivers outstanding tensile and stiffness properties, ensuring that the Lightweight 3K Plain Twill Carbon Hybrid Fabric remains robust and unyielding. This vital attribute is indispensable for applications that demand materials that are not only lightweight but also exhibit superior mechanical characteristics.

Impact Resistance:
By ingeniously integrating aramid fibers, such as Kevlar, renowned for their impressive impact resistance and toughness, our fabric significantly enhances the composite's ability to absorb energy and withstand impacts. This makes it exceptionally well-suited for applications where superior impact resistance is non-negotiable.

Weight Reduction:
Recognized for its remarkable lightweight properties, carbon fiber plays a crucial role in reducing the overall weight of composite structures. This weight reduction is particularly advantageous in fields like aerospace and automotive industries, where saving weight translates to better fuel efficiency and enhanced performance, setting a new standard in innovation.

Application

Aerospace and Aviation:
Within the aerospace realm, carbon-aramid hybrid fabrics are indispensable for crafting components necessitating exceptional strength, unmatched stiffness, and superior impact resistance. These materials are integral in the construction of aircraft fuselages, wings, and other vital structural elements.

Automotive:
In the dynamic world of automotive engineering, these cutting-edge hybrid fabrics pave the way for high-performance and racing vehicles. They are essential for manufacturing body panels, robust chassis, and protective gear such as helmets and racing suits.

Sports Equipment:
Thanks to their feather-light weight and impressive strength, carbon-aramid hybrid fabrics revolutionize sports equipment production, from advanced bicycles to resilient hockey sticks, and high-performance protective gear for various athletic endeavors.

Marine:
Navigating the marine industry, these exceptional fabrics play a critical role in the construction of durable boat hulls, sails, and components that demand high strength and resistance against water and impact.

Defense:
In defense applications, carbon-aramid hybrid fabrics are a cornerstone for crafting body armor, helmets, and vehicle armor, offering high impact resistance and superior protective attributes.

Industrial:
Across various industrial sectors, these remarkable hybrid fabrics meet the demands for high strength and durability, finding their place in conveyor belts, protective clothing, and numerous other robust components.

Construction:
In construction, carbon-aramid hybrid fabrics are key for reinforcing concrete, repairing buildings, and fortifying bridges and tunnels, ensuring resilience and enhanced structural integrity.

Specification
Code Weave Weight(g/m2) Thickness(mm) W(mm)*L(m)
KA305/100P-YB Plain 100 0.11 1000*100
KA305/190P-YB Plain 190 0.27 1000*100
KA305/190T-YB Twill 190 0.27 1000*100
KA305/190P-BRO Plain 190 0.27 1000*100
KA305/190T-BRO Twill 190 0.27 1000*100
KA305/190I-YB "I" WEAVE 190 0.28 1000*100
